FOW's Progress on Warming Shed

By Denise Larrabee December 22, 2011

Volunteers from FOW’s Structures Crew worked a total of 789 hours during the fall, working primarily at Andorra and the warming shed at Valley Green, which burned down in October 2010 due to an electrical fire during a rain storm. Crew leader Mike Souders estimates that the shed will be finished by the Spring of 2012. The Pennsylvania Equine Council and FOW organized the "Ride to Rebuild" in November 2010 that raised over $8,000 toward the estimated construction cost of $20,000. Members from Courtesy Stable in Roxborough, Monastery Stable in Mount Airy, and Northwestern Stable in Chestnut Hill all participated in the fundraising effort, as well as riders from New Jersey, Harrisburg, and York.
